Description

The EGO POWER+ 21” Single-Stage Snow Blower with Peak Power™ is EGO’s most powerful single-stage snow blower, delivering the power and performance of gas-powered snow blowers without the noise, fuss, and fumes. Featuring Peak Power™ technology, this cordless snow blower combines the power of any two EGO 56V ARC Lithium™ batteries for the performance to clear even the heaviest, wettest snow with a throwing distance up to 45 feet. Built with a high- efficiency brushless motor and steel auger, this cordless electric snow blower handles what the city snowplow leaves behind with ease, cutting through ice and snow with up to 50% more power than SNT2110. Conveniently adjust the pitch and direction of where snow is thrown from the handle-mounted chute controls. Heated handle grips help keep your hands warm in the coldest, snowiest conditions. Clear up to a 14-car driveway with 8 inches of snow on a single charge with two recommended 6.0Ah ARC Lithium™ batteries (available separately). Based on some of the comments, I'm not sure that all are reviewing the newer model LMT-2130/34 with a few enhancements over some of EGO's older models that have been around a while. This blower has had plenty of power for the type of wet snow we tend to get. So far I've had to use it five times and the highest snow total was 5 inches, so keep that in mind when comparing. If you're in an area that typically sees storm totals under 10 inches or so - this single stage might be what you're looking for. There is plenty of power to move snow and the only time I had to worry about the chute plugging was going through the salted/icy slush left by snow plows at the end of the driveway, and that was only one out of five times I've used it so far. When the chute plugs, it is fairly easy to clear just by tilting lifting front off pavement and dropping it back down to shake the pluggage clear without removing your hands from the handlebar. The blower itself weighs approximately the same as a lawnmower so this action doesn't take a lot of strength or weight. The main complaints about previous versions seemed to be about getting stuck in driveway cracks, etc. and the resulting wear on the steel auger and scraper bar. With the new skid shoes on this model, I've not had it catch on any concrete cracks at all, and it pretty dependably scrapes down to pavement in one pass. In my limited use so far, the scraper bar hasn't worn at all. The up/down tilt of the chute on this model is rock solid as opposed to previous model reviews where it tended to get loose and drift after a while. It was nice to be able to control that from the handlebar, although it isn't something I change a lot. The side to side adjustment is quick and easy. Not a change from the previous model, but a huge improvement from the single stage front discharge blower I had previously. This difference is way more about user comfort than moving snow, as you can easily direct the snow to keep you out of the cloud of snow you create. This model doesn't come with batteries, but I've found that two 7.5Ah batteries running full speed can easily handle a residential driveway and sidewalk with about half capacity remaining. There really isn't a need to run full auger speed all the time, though. Being able to dial this down seems very helpful in smaller more powdery snowfalls. Overall very happy with this blower, the time it has saved me, and how much clearer I've been able to keep my driveway and sidewalks compared to years past with manual shoveling. ... show more

I recently picked up this EGO Power+ 21" blower, and I’ve been thoroughly impressed by how powerful it is given its lightweight size. I have used it to clear about 5 to 6 inches of accumulation, ranging from light dry powder to heavy wet slush, and it clears it all without hesitation. It is definitely a capable machine for moderate snowfalls. Feature-wise, the battery life has been excellent; it provides ample runtime to clear my entire driveway on a single charge without needing to stop. I use two 4ah EGO batteries. I also found the heated handles to be incredibly useful. I didn't think much of them at first, but they make a significant difference when you are out in the freezing cold for an extended period. The only real trade-off to consider is that, because it is a single-stage blower, it isn't self-propelled. You do have to use some force to push it, unlike larger two-stage gas blowers that pull themselves along. However, if you don't mind putting in a little physical effort, the performance and convenience of this electric unit make it a solid choice. ... show more
